Blake Shelton and his new girlfriend Gwen Stefani are slowly making their romance public, but that doesn't mean the pair is ready to meet each other's friends. Fellow country singer and Shelton's longtime friend Luke Bryan recently opened up about the "Sangria" singer’s new relationship and admitted he's never met Stefani.

"[Blake] doesn't want me to hug her or anything," Bryan joked with Entertainment Tonight Wednesday at the CMT Artists of the Year Awards. "He doesn't want me to meet her."

The "Kick The Dust Up" singer also joked that Stefani might need her eyes checked if she's interested in Shelton.

“My stepmother is an optometrist. And I’m trying to get Gwen an appointment with her," he said.

As previously reported, reps for Shelton and Stefani confirmed they were a couple in November ahead of the CMA Awards. The "Hollaback" singer, however, still won’t admit she’s dating her “The Voice” co-star even though she's been spotted a few times FaceTiming him.

Most recently, Stefani was seen walking around Disneyland in Anaheim, California, with her sons while video chatting with Shelton. Bryan explained to Entertainment Tonight that Shelton and Stefani probably FaceTime so much because the 39-year-old "has no service" in his Los Angeles home.

"You have to FaceTime him to talk," he explained.

Shelton also opened up about being caught FaceTiming his girlfriend telling "Access Hollywood" that he was shocked to see the photos pop up online.

“These people -- they get these pictures! What I [though] was like, ‘Hey! Look at this cool stuff at Disneyland!’ And the next thing I see is a picture of Gwen holding my face up at Disneyland,” he said.
